Buckling of the multi-vaulted \"Aster\" shell under axial compression alone or combined with an external pressure
Araar M, Derbali M, Jullien JF
Abstract
This paper presents a study of buckling of the multi-vaulted cylindrical shell (\"Aster\"), under an axial compression alone or combined with an external pressure. This shell which was presented in a recent paper is a self-stiffened structure having a satisfactory behaviour and a higher buckling strength under external pressure than a circular cylindrical shell with the same dimensions. The results of this study emphasize the interest of the behaviour of the \"Aster\" shell under two other types of loading, revealing an acceptable level of strength which is favorable for an expansion of its use in other areas.
